The VALUE COLLECTION 70017 is a precision dowel pin engineered for accurate component alignment and positioning in mechanical assemblies. Manufactured from Grade 8 alloy steel with a bright finish, this pin measures 6 mm in diameter and 20 mm in overall length with rounded ends. It conforms to DIN 6325 and ISO 8734 standards, making it a reliable choice for applications where tight tolerances and consistent fit are required. Machinists, tool-and-die technicians, and maintenance mechanics install these pins in jigs, fixtures, dies, and precision machine components where repeatable part location is critical.
This dowel pin is suited for light to medium-duty industrial and manufacturing applications requiring precise bore-to-bore or part-to-plate alignment. The rounded end profile aids smooth insertion into reamed or precision-bored holes. Each package contains 25 pins, making it practical for production environments, repair shops, and tool rooms that need on-hand inventory of a standard metric size. The DIN 6325 and ISO 8734 compliance ensures dimensional interchangeability with components manufactured to those same standards.

Precision dowel pins are typically pressed or driven into reamed holes by machinists or maintenance mechanics using an arbor press or dead-blow mallet. Holes should be reamed to the appropriate tolerance class for the intended fit — interference, transition, or slip — before installation. Always de-burr mating holes and clean components before pressing pins into place to avoid galling or dimensional distortion. Follow applicable facility and equipment safety lockout procedures before disassembling or reassembling machinery.
